Global Times September 18, 2023
Has China's Shanghai turned into a "ghost town"? This "nonsense" that can be easily distinguished by both Chinese people and foreigners with basic common sense has astonishingly become the headline of an article in the well-established American news magazine, Newsweek. There are indeed people playing tricks behind this...More